This manual is separated into three main sections:
Using DEQX Calibrated™ - Step by step: A good starting point walks you through common
procedures.
Using DEQX Calibrated™ - Reference: Provides a more detailed description of parameters and
processes.
Finally, the Appendices provide additional information, such as a Glossary of Terms, and a
comprehensive list of all Warnings and Error Messages.
Throughout this manual, certain terms will be used with specific meanings:
Choose:
Choose a menu option. Menu options are separated by dashes e.g.: Choose File-
Open:
Open means click the File menu, then click the Open menu option. Choose is also used for
clicking a tab in a tabbed dialog. Menu options can also be chosen with the selected with the
navigation keys and activated with the Enter key.
Select:
Select an option in a list box or combo box.
Click:
Left click with the mouse on a button or icon. Buttons and icons may also be selected using the
navigation keys and activated with the Enter key.
Enter:
Type text in a text box then move the focus from the text box to confirm the entry. It may not be
appropriate to press the Enter key, as this may activate a selected command button. Instead you
can move the focus by pressing the Tab key or clicking another control on the dialog.
Menu options and available selections are displayed in bold.*
